Early 20th Century "Tradesman Lamp" By Anton Chotka For The Bergman Foundry

£6,850    $8,553    €8,202
An important early 20th Century cold-painted Austrian bronze study of an Arab tradesman selling his wares underneath a rug strewn awning and lantern lamp. with very fine hand chased surface detail and and good naturalistic colour, signed Chotka and stamped with the Bergman foundry ''B'' in a vase
